Try searching this forum for 'vaccuum' you can usually find a previous post on the topic you're looking for. Sounds like a leak or you need to install the check valve that needed to be added to most GC's.

Take a much harder look at your vaccuum hoses all over. I dealt with this during the heat this summer and found where a line going in through my firewall had been rubbing and finally developed a leak. The minute I had it patched the vents were working again. I patched it quick by using the crevice tool from WD/40 or PB Blaster inside to bridge the line but later a small piece of fuel line for a RC engine did a perfect patch over the break.
